Animated Scarecrow Traits
Your Scarecrow has the following traits.Ability Score Increase
Your Dexterity score increases by 1, and one other ability score of your choice increases by 2.
Age
As an animated bundle of straw, it's hard to say how long your lifespan will be. In theory, you could live a very long time until your body molds and rots - or you could be gone in an instant by walking too close to a candle.
Alignment
Your life is fleeting, and most scarecrows aren't alive by choice. Nobody would fault you for tending toward chaos and neutrality, or even evil. If this body is a curse, though, and you seek to repent or make amends, you may choose to take a different path.
Size
Your size is Medium. To set your height and weight randomly, start with rolling a size modifier:
Size modifier = 2d6
Height = 5 feet + 10 inches + your size modifier in inches
Weight in pounds = 270 + (4 × your size modifier)
Speed
Your base walking speed is 30 feet.
Body of Straw
You were created to have remarkable fortitude, represented by the following benefits:
- You have advantage on saving throws against being poisoned, and you have resistance to poison damage.
- You are vulnerable to fire damage,
- You don’t need to eat, drink, or breathe.
- You are immune to disease.
- You don’t need to sleep, and magic can’t put you to sleep.
Sentry’s Rest
When you take a long rest, you must spend at least six hours in an inactive, motionless state, rather than sleeping. In this state, you appear inert, but it doesn’t render you unconscious, and you can see and hear as normal.
Natural Camouflage
As an action, you can use the strange nature of your body to your advantage when attempting to hide. There are two ways you can do so:
Blend in
You attempt to camouflage yourself into your surroundings. While blending in you may attempt to hide from a creature or person that would otherwise have direct lines of sight on you (excluding truesight or tremmorsense). You can make attacks and cast spells as normal and your speed is reduced to 5'
Deflate
You can deflate your body and collapse to the ground, superficially appearing to be a pile of rags, twigs, or scraps of wood. While fully disassembled, you cannot attack, cast spells, or move yourself via physical means. You gain advantage on all Dexterity (Stealth) checks, plus your proficiency. Your speed is reduced to 0.'
You can choose either at will but any use of this feature counts as an Action (e.g.: switching from blending-in to fully-deflated will require you to use your Action, as would re-corporealizing from a pile of scraps) .
Specialized Design
You gain one skill proficiency and one tool proficiency of your choice.
Languages
You can speak, read, and write Common and one other language of your choice.
